Sam Williams is juggling fatherhood and cricket with Raiders preseason training

Sam Williams' face says it all. It radiates pride, and has done ever since his wife Sarah gave birth to Archie early last month. But there's a also mischievous twinkle in the eyes of the Canberra Raiders halfback, who is doubling up as a co-captain for North Canberra-Gungahlin in the Cricket ACT premier grade competition this summer.

"We had little Archie on Friday morning at about 1am so I was in hospital for the 24 hours with Sarah, and then slid out the back door and went and played a game of cricket.
